Integrated Device Technology Low Skew,1-to-6,Crystal/LVCMOS/Differential-to-3.3V,2.5V LVPECL Fanout Buffer 8536AG-01LFT

Description
The 8536-01 is a low skew, high performance 1-to-6 Selectable Crystal, Single-Ended, or Differential Input-to-3.3V, 2.5V LVPECL Fanout Buffer and a member of the HiPerClockS™ family of High Performance Clock Solutions from IDT . The 8536-01 has selectable crystal, single ended or differential clock inputs. The single ended clock input accepts LVCMOS or LVTTL input levels and translates them to LVPECL levels. The CLK1 , nCLK1 pair can accept most standard differential input levels. The output enable is internally synchronized to eliminate runt pulses on the outputs during asynchronous assertion/deassertio n of the clock enable pin. Guaranteed output and part-to-part skew characteristics make the 8536-01 ideal for those applications demanding well defined performance and repeatability.
